Brazilian highlight on the preliminary card of UFC 311, next Saturday (18), Jailton Malhadinho is known not only for his skills inside the octagon, but also for his irreverence outside of it. This virtue captivated none other than Khabib Nurmagomedov behind the scenes of the week of the event.

In a social media post, Malhadinho, affectionately nicknamed 'Malhadomedov' by fans due to his similarities to Khabib's fighting style (of whom he has admitted to being a fan), documented a fun encounter with his idol backstage at the UFC 311 press conference.

In the video, Malhadinho instructs Khabib to say the name of his gym Galpão da Luta, as well as the traditional expression 'punch in the head'. In the end, the Russian, on his own, scratched out some Portuguese to praise the Bahian.

“Fight Shed. Punch to the head. This fighter is very good,” said Khabib.

Ranked sixth in the heavyweight division (up to 120,2 kg) and eyeing a title shot, Jailton Malhadinho faces Serghei Spivac on the preliminary card of UFC 311.

Khabib Nurmagomedov will be present at the event as the coach of Islam Makhachev, who defends his lightweight title (up to 70,3 kg) against Arman Tsarukyan in the main event, Umar Nurmagomedov, who fights for the bantamweight title (up to 61,2 kg) against Merab Dvalishvili in the co-main event, and Tagir Ulanbekov, who faces Clayton Carpenter in the opening fight of the preliminary card.
